What's the best way to share photos and your location with friends and family while on the trail? I want to be able to share both simultaneously. I like the Spot gps for its safety capabilities and great tracking methods but I want to share photos as well.

A smartphone such as a BlackBerry seems like it would work great for uploading pictures but what app would be best to use for location? Does an app like that work with just any hosting website for tracking? Basically I don't want to worry about trying to find somewhere to get online in towns.

Also if anybody knows a simple website to use to upload pics and map locations for friends to follow I would like to know. Just something with an easy link.

My Garmin Oregon 550 geoencodes the pictures it takes. All I have to do is upload those pictures to a Google Picassa photo album and it shows a map alongside the picture that shows where the picture was shot.

For an inexpensive means of keeping family & friends updated on your location, consider TrailPhone.net (http://trailphone.net/bighodag). You enter the nearest mileage and then record an audio message. TrailPhone puts an icon on a map showing your approximate position on the trail. Currently, there's no photo option.

For photos, you might consider uploading them to Picassa. Google enables you to set a lat/long for each picture. Then the photos can be displayed on a larger Google Map in sequence. You can upload to Picasa via email I believe. FYI - Many hikers update blogs & albums when in town or at hostels.
